Output 68e325499e388a9ae32b2428503ae83d027bf5a60ef1ac7ad72552a5459c6ec1:1

value
67075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21b422b5f90e5ef23de3f35feb326eb95d36d67 OP_EQUAL
address
3NJZHrDjEUD56R97FQQDTvwpuYCgdhQsNh
transaction
68e325499e388a9ae32b2428503ae83d027bf5a60ef1ac7ad72552a5459c6ec1
spent
true